lots of househeads started off listening to trance, that's no secret here. It's a natural progression, imo, as several house djs play trance tracks in their sets anyways, (or trancey-sounding house tracks ... as well as techno).

But in feeding off the dancefloor, those djs also keep those epic trancey breaks to a minimum, keeping the crowd's feet moving in the process. They may even use trance during crowd interaction or for setting up those monster floor busting house beats. Djs like Lawler, Sasha, or Calderone have the abilities to move any crowd, imo, with the kind of edm diversity to their sets that even tranceheads can/should appreciate.
